產品經理怎樣寫后臺系統的交互說明?
產品經理的工作中常常要寫后臺系統的交互說明,筆者在本文系統介紹了如何寫交互說明,分享給大家。
一、交互說明是什么?
原型圖上的注釋、對交互及數據限制做出說明。
二、交互說明誰在看?
UI設計師/前后端開發者/測試人員。
三、交互說明的意義是什么?
解釋原型圖中的頁面邏輯,降低協同開發過程中的溝通成本。
四、交互說明包含什么?
1. 修訂記錄
修訂記錄一般置于原型圖的首頁,用于在整體協同過程中了解每個人對原型修改的內容及修改時間。
2. 需求說明
列出在當前頁面的需求點列表,包含需求的具體內容和覆蓋后臺頁面的數量,避免開發過程中出現頁面遺漏的現象。
3. 業務背景
幫助開發者更高效的理解做該功能的目的和在什么場景下使用。
4. 原型中的說明
1)交互形式/頁面流程
包含點擊、長按和鼠標hover后的展示形式,說明頁面間的點擊跳轉關系、不同角色及登錄狀態下的頁面展示、頁面上不同元素及按鈕在不同角色場景下的跳轉與變化。
2)數據來源/頁面內容
標注哪些內容字段是寫死的,哪些是上傳的、從哪里上傳。
3)默認狀態
默認狀態包括文本框默認文案、下拉框默認選項及列表的默認排序規則。
4)頁面埋點
考慮當前頁面需要在哪些地方埋點,方便后期通過拉取數據感知該功能在實際業務中的使用情況,根據使用情況判斷對該功能進行優化時主次。
5)限制條件
若涉及到填表的部分,說明中應該寫清限制條件,包括字段長度的最大值和最小值、圖片或文檔的格式及大小。
6)操作類型
操作類型包括正確操作、錯誤操作、異常報錯,分別列舉出可能出現的情況及操作后的提示文案。
五、后臺交互說明應該注意什么?
1. 整體框架
1)上方為系統標題和登錄信息,左側為菜單欄,列表頁、查看頁、表單頁。
2)一般來說,后臺很多操作頁面樣式都很相似,為了減少誤操作的可能,所有頁面頂部為面包屑頁面路徑顯示,提醒用戶當前所在頁面。
2. 列表頁
1)篩選項
篩選類型包括輸入文本的篩選和下拉篩選。原型中需要標注篩選類型是輸入文本還是下拉篩選,如果是下拉篩選還要寫清下拉列表的內容。
2)操作
需寫清操作權限、不同角色點擊后跳轉情況。
3)列表
注意列表字段排序、列表中記錄每個字段的數據來源說明、列表排序規則和權限。
六、后臺系統的權限設計
為滿足后臺系統不同登陸者的需求而設置權限細分,權限設計包含頁面權限、數據權限和操作權限。
1. 頁面權限
頁面權限指用戶是否能夠查看這個頁面及頁面中的數據。在實際操作中,我們對該用戶的菜單中配置了菜單,即該用戶享有了該頁面的頁面權限。
2. 數據權限
數據權限分為“僅自己的數據”、“部門內數據”、“全部數據”。
- “僅自己的數據”指用戶在系統中的數據為自己管理的數據;
- “部門內數據”指用戶在系統中的數據為部門內的所有數據;
- “全部數據”指用戶在系統中的數據包含后臺中的所有數據,“全部數據”是系統中最高級別的數據權限。
3. 操作權限
例如在CRM系統中,一線銷售人員、銷售組長和銷售經理三個角色為崗位層級遞增的三個角色。
不同角色對系統中數據進行增刪改查的操作范圍不同,組長和經理可以通過“選擇組內成員”的篩選操作查看他們的數據,一線銷售人員沒有此項操作。
作者:Caroline;公眾號:產品經理的日與夜
本文由 @Caroline 原創發布于人人都是產品經理,未經許可,禁止轉載
題圖來自 Unsplash,基于 CC0 協議
什么事crm
挺全的!優秀
不錯,同意上樓意見
不錯,搭配圖片食用更佳